De-dollarisation
De-dollarisation, the decreased reliance on the US greenback as a reserve and transaction forex, is immensely difficult because the dominant position of the US greenback has outlined the worldwide monetary system for greater than 75 years. The greenback has continued its sturdy place for 3 foremost causes: the large measurement of the US financial system, the preservation of the greenback’s worth by holding inflation low, and the open and liquid monetary market. Because the US financial system is in relative decline, inflation is uncontrolled, and its monetary markets are used as a weapon – the foundations for the enduring position of the greenback are rapidly coming to an finish.
A monetary partnership between China and Russia, the world’s largest power importer and the world’s largest power exporter, is an indispensable instrument for dethroning the petrodollar. In 2015, roughly 90% of commerce between Russia and China was settled in {dollars}, and by 2020, dollar-denominated commerce between the 2 Eurasian giants had nearly decreased by half, with solely 46% of commerce in {dollars}. Russia has additionally been main the best way in reducing the share of US {dollars} in its overseas reserves. The mechanisms for de-dollarizing China-Russia commerce are additionally used to finish the usage of the dollar with third events – with developments being seen in locations akin to Latin America, Turkey, Iran, India, and so on. Monetary transactions
The SWIFT system for monetary transactions between banks worldwide was beforehand the one system for worldwide funds. This central position for SWIFT started to erode when the US used it as a political weapon. The People first expelled Iran and North Korea, and in 2014, Washington started threatening to expel Russia from the system as nicely. Over the previous few weeks, the specter of utilizing SWIFT as a weapon in opposition to Russia has intensified.
China has responded by creating CIPS and Russia developed SPFS, each being options to SWIFT. Even a number of different European international locations have banded along with an alternative choice to SWIFT to curb Washington’s extra-territorial jurisdiction and thus proceed buying and selling with Iran. A brand new China-Russia monetary structure ought to combine CIPS and SPFS, and make them extra accessible to 3rd events. If the US expels Russia, then the decoupling from SWIFT would intensify additional.
Improvement banks
The US-led IMF, World Financial institution and Asian Improvement Financial institution are famend devices of US financial statecraft. The launch of the Chinese language-led Asian Infrastructure Funding Financial institution (AIIB) in 2015 grew to become a watershed second within the international monetary structure, as all the main allies of the US (besides Japan) signed up in defiance of American warnings. The New Improvement Financial institution, previously known as the BRICS Improvement Financial institution, was an additional step in direction of decoupling from the US-led improvement banks. The Eurasian Improvement Financial institution and future SCO Improvement Financial institution are extra nails within the coffin of US-controlled improvement banks.
